Q & A
Question Answer
I want to enjoy 5.1 Ch surround sound of Dolby
digital, DST, etc. What equipment do I need?
• A This unit alone is not enough. You will need 6 speakers and, if a digital connection, an amp
equipped with Dolby digital or DST recorder. (DVD playback only)
Can I play DVD-Video, DVD-Audio and Video
CDs purchased abroad?
• You can play them if the video standard is NTSC.
• A Only if the regional code includes “ALL” or “1”. Check the package.
Can a DVD-Video that does not have a region
number be played?
• The DVD-Video region number indicates the disc conforms to a standard. You cannot play discs that
do not have a region number.
Can I use DVD-R and DVD-RW in this unit?
• A Only a DVD-R that has been finalized can be used. DVD-RW cannot be used.
• This unit also record and plays 1×-4× recording speed DVD-R discs.
Can I use CD-R and CD-RW in this unit?
• A CD-R and CD-RW recorded with finalized MP3 music will play. However, this unit does not allow
CD-R and CD-RW recording.
Can I record from a video or outside DVD
source?
• A Most video tape and DVD titles on the market are copy protected. In this case, recording is not
possible.
Can I play DVD-Rs recorded on this unit on
other machines?
• A Once a DVD-R recorded on this unit is finalized, it can be played on other DVD-R compatible
machines. (It is not guaranteed to work with all machines.) It may not play depending on recording
conditions.
Can I record digital audio signals on this unit? • This is not possible.
How many times can I rewrite a DVD-RAM? • A This varies based on conditions of usage, but they can be rewritten up to about 100 000 times.
Can I record from a commercially purchased
video cassette or DVD?
• Most commercially sold video cassettes and DVD are copy protected; therefore, recording is usually
not possible.
Can a digital audio signal during DVD playback
be recorded to other equipment?
• You can record if using the PCM signal. When recording DVD, change the “Digital Audio Output”
settings to the following from the SETUP menu.
- PCM Down Conversion: On
- Dolby Digital: PCM
- DTS: PCM
However, only
- As long as digital recording from the disc is permitted.
- As long as the recording equipment is compatible with a sampling frequency of 48 kHz.
You cannot record MP3 signals.
The precision parts in this unit are readily affected by the environment, especially temperature, humidity, and dust. Cigarette
smoke also can cause malfunction or breakdown.
To clean this unit, wipe with a soft, dry cloth.
• Never use alcohol, paint thinner or benzine to clean this unit.
• Before using chemically treated cloth, read the instructions for the cloth carefully.
• Use eyeglass cleaner to remove stubborn dirt from the LCD.
Observe the following points to ensure continued listening and viewing pleasure.
Dust and dirt may adhere to the unit’s lenses over time, possibly making it impossible to record or play discs.
Use the recommended DVD-RAM/PD Lens cleaner (LF-K123LCA1) about once every year, depending on frequency of use and the
operating environment.
Read the lens cleaner’s instructions carefully before use.
